Why Dental Rubber Bands For Thin Hair Is Necessary

I’ve found that dental rubber bands are especially helpful for thin hair because they provide a much stronger hold than regular hair ties. My hair tends to slip out of most elastics, but these small bands grip tightly and keep my style in place without needing to wrap them too many times. That makes them a practical choice when I want a neat ponytail, braid, or small section secured for the day.

I also like that they work well for delicate styles. Since thin hair can easily look bulky with larger bands, dental rubber bands help me create a cleaner and more natural finish. My hairstyles look more polished, and I don’t have to worry as much about the band showing or weighing my hair down.

Another reason I consider them necessary is convenience. I can use them for quick styling, sectioning hair for braids, or keeping small pieces controlled while I get ready. For me, they are a simple tool that makes thin hair easier to manage and style with less frustration.

My Buying Guides on Dental Rubber Bands For Thin Hair

When I started looking for dental rubber bands for thin hair, I quickly realized that not all small elastics are the same. My hair is fine and delicate, so I needed bands that could hold securely without pulling, slipping, or causing breakage. Here’s the buying guide I would use based on my own experience.

1. I Look for Gentle Material

The first thing I check is the material. For thin hair, I prefer soft, stretchy rubber bands that feel smooth and flexible. Harsh or stiff bands can snag my strands and make my hair more prone to damage. I always choose bands that seem gentle enough for daily use.

2. I Pay Attention to Band Size

Since my hair is thin, I don’t need oversized bands. Smaller dental rubber bands usually work better because they wrap tightly without needing too many turns. If the band is too large, it tends to slip out of my hair. A snug fit matters more than a tight grip.

3. I Check for Strong Hold Without Pulling

I want a band that keeps my hairstyle in place, but I never want it to tug at my scalp. The best dental rubber bands for thin hair give me a secure hold while still feeling comfortable. If I notice pulling, I know the band is probably not the right one for me.

4. I Prefer Smooth Edges

Rough seams or edges can catch on fine hair easily. I always look for bands with a smooth finish because they slide on and off more easily. This helps me avoid breakage when I’m tying my hair up or removing the band later.

5. I Consider Elasticity

Good elasticity is important to me because I want the band to stretch without snapping too quickly. If a band loses its shape after one or two uses, it’s not worth buying. I usually choose bands that bounce back well and stay usable for multiple styles.

6. I Think About Hair Damage

My thin hair breaks easily, so I avoid bands that are too tight or too sticky. I look for dental rubber bands that are designed to reduce friction. The less stress on my hair, the better my results over time.

7. I Choose the Right Color and Visibility

Sometimes I like bands that blend into my hair color, especially for a neat look. Other times, I prefer clear or neutral bands that stay discreet. For me, this is a small detail, but it makes my hairstyle look more polished.

8. I Check Packaging and Quantity

I like buying dental rubber bands in packs with enough quantity to last me a while. Thin hair-friendly bands can be easy to lose, so having extras is helpful. I also check whether the packaging keeps the bands clean and organized.

9. I Read Reviews Before Buying

Before I buy, I always read reviews from people with fine or thin hair. Their feedback helps me understand whether the bands slip, stretch well, or cause breakage. Reviews save me from wasting money on products that sound good but don’t work in real life.

10. I Match the Band to My Hairstyle Needs

I think about how I’ll use the bands. For small braids, ponytails, or sectioning hair, I need different levels of hold. The best dental rubber bands for my thin hair are the ones that fit my everyday styling habits.
